Frequently Asked Questions
What specific local zoning or land use issues in Twin Bridges, CA, should I discuss with a real estate attorney?
Given Twin Bridges' location in El Dorado County and its proximity to the American River and protected forest lands, a local attorney can advise on strict zoning regulations for building near waterways, septic system requirements in rural areas, and any county-specific parcel size or use restrictions that differ from other parts of California. They are crucial for navigating the El Dorado County Planning Department's requirements.
How can a Twin Bridges real estate attorney help with a property transaction involving a well or septic system?
In this rural, unincorporated community, most properties rely on private wells and septic systems. An attorney will ensure the purchase agreement includes contingencies for water flow and quality tests, septic system inspections, and compliance with the El Dorado County Environmental Management Department. They can also review easements for shared well access, which is common in the area.
Are there unique title issues a real estate attorney in Twin Bridges should check for due to its history?
Yes. A local attorney will conduct a thorough title search for unrecorded easements (like historical mining or logging access rights), old parcel splits that may not meet current county standards, and potential claims related to the area's Gold Rush history. They ensure clear title for properties that may have complex, multi-generational ownership histories common in the Sierra foothills.
What should I expect to pay for a real estate attorney's services for a residential closing in Twin Bridges, CA?
Fees typically range from $1,500 to $3,500 for a standard residential transaction, depending on complexity. This is often a flat fee covering document review, title coordination, and closing. Costs may be higher for properties with unique water rights, boundary disputes, or if dealing with probate sales, which are not uncommon in this established community.
When buying vacant land in Twin Bridges for building, what legal services are essential?
Beyond standard closing services, an attorney should verify buildability by checking El Dorado County's General Plan and zoning maps, investigating any CC&Rs from older subdivisions, confirming legal road access (as some roads may be private), and ensuring the parcel has a legal building site that complies with setbacks from creeks and slope stability regulations in this mountainous terrain.
